Ted On Jun 8, 2009, at 10:32 AM, Ronald J Kimball wrote: > > On Mon, Jun 08, 2009 at 07:00:00AM -0700, RobS wrote: > >> I use the following little thing to add BR tags to the end of lines >> I've selected... >> Find: \r >> Replace: <br />\r >> ...with "Selected text only" checked. > >> How can the Find/Replace pattern be improved so it skips over blank >> lines and any line ending in </p>? > > Try this: > > Find > (?<!^|</p>)\r > > Replace > <br />\r > > (?<!...) is a negative look-behind. It matches if the next part of > the > regex is not preceded by whatever is in the look-behind. > > > Ronald > > > *********************** Ted Burger **************************** [email protected] ********* www.tobsupport.com --~--~---------~--~----~------------~-------~--~----~ You received this message because you are subscribed to the Google Groups "BBEdit Talk" group.
